共查询到20条相似文献,搜索用时 8 毫秒
1.
VB中端口I/O操作的实现 总被引:1,自引:0,他引:1
Visual Basic作为一种非常方便的Windows应用程序开发平台,可以实现Windows的绝大多数功能。但是VB却缺乏端口输入输出函数,而且Windows API(应用程序接口)也没有提供端口输入输出的能力。但是,在实际工程应用中(例如报警信号的检测),我们用VB做好了界面,底层操作往往需要端口的读写(I/O)。因为像自己设计的仪器控制器这样的硬件,Windows是无法提供访问权的。幸好VB提供了动态链接库(DLL)功能,可以通过用其他高级语语言(如Borland C )建立的DLL来解决。下面就如何建立端口读写的DLL以及怎样调用相应的函数作一介绍。 相似文献
2.
I/O计算机是类似计算器式的小型手握计算机,它对工业控制提供智能控制,能减少硬件设计时间,降低工发成本,增加故障容限以及提供合适的系统配置,本文介绍I/O计算机的硬件组成结构,软件设计,功能特点及I/O语言。 相似文献
3.
VB和Delphi下访问I/O端口 总被引:2,自引:0,他引:2
在微型计算机应用日益普及的今天,出现了所谓虚拟仪器。就组成而言,虚拟仪器实质上是以微机为工作平台,配置了具有特定功能的扩展接口卡,并用微机屏幕模拟显示实际仪器的控制和操作面板,形象、直观;而在功能上,虚拟仪器能完全或部分地取代传统类型的仪器。它充分利用了微机的控制、处理能力和图形功能,因而使用起来更为方便,代表了微机应用的一个方向。 开发虚拟仪器的功能,少不了针对输入输出端口的操作。尽管有专用的虚拟仪器编程工具,但某些情况下,自主开发更为实际和有意义。 面向对象的可视化编程工具,为我们提供了开发虚拟仪 相似文献
4.
Visual Basic(VB)是一种可视化编程语言,也是多媒体应用程序的可选开发工具.由于具有好学、易用及较高的开发效率而受到众多用户的青睐.它确实能适应相当多应用的需要,但是没有端口输入输出函数(Windows也没有提供端口输入输出函数),因而没有I/O端口访问功能,使一些用VB开发的应用程序无法访问一些外部设备,实现诸如仪器、仪表的实时控制及信号处理.而在传统的程序设计语言中端口输入输出函数是很常见的.本文将提出一 相似文献
5.
6.
在Windows 2000平台上实现VB对I/O端口操作 总被引:1,自引:0,他引:1
开发一个基于I/O端口操作的设备驱动程序,再编写一个动态链接库,从而可使Windows2000平台上的VB也能对I/O端口进行操作。文中就此介绍编写动态链接库时涉及到的关键问题,并给出了部分源代码。 相似文献
7.
8.
黄沛芳 《单片机与嵌入式系统应用》2002,(2):76-77
MCS-51单片机通常有4个8位I/O端口,向各端口的写数据均写入到对应端口的锁存器中,但对各端口的读操作却有两个方式:读锁存器和读引脚。 相似文献
9.
10.
《单片机与嵌入式系统应用》2002,(12):41-41
MAX47300是Maxim近期推出的串行接口I/O扩展外设,能够为微处理器提供最多28个端口,每个端口可分别配置成逻辑输入或逻辑输出:具有10mA吸电流和4.5mA灌电流的推拉式逻辑输出或施密特(Schmitt)逻辑输入。其中的七个端口还可以配置为瞬变检测逻辑,当端口逻辑电平变化时产生中断。MAX7300通过兼容于I~2C的2线接口进行控制,两 相似文献
11.
各种语言下的打印口直接I/O访问编程 总被引:2,自引:1,他引:2
本文在简介了包括最新使用的各种打印口后,给出了各种主要编程语言进行打印端口的直接I/O访问的接口程度,可以满足非打印情况下的各检测,控制等的使用,这里对端可以满足非打印情况下的各种检测,控制等的使用,这里对端口的操作速度也进行了分析,有利于读者对口的选择。 相似文献
12.
VisualBasic(VB)是一个完整全面的程序设计语言,是一种非常方便的Windows应用程序开发平台,可以实现Windows的绝大多数功能。它最有力的一面就是快速创建用户界面,把复杂而完善的Windows操作系统的使用融于易于学习和使用的高级语言中,因而受到广大工程技术人员的普遍欢迎。然而VB也有不足之处,即它不含Windows的全部技术细节,因此缺乏对某些资源的支持,如不能对低层端口进行访问。这就给实际应用带来许多不便。在工业控制中,经常用到需在微机扩展槽中插上自行设计的扩展卡,以实现对… 相似文献
13.
本文以UNIX系统下echo服务的编程实现为例,系统介绍各种I/O方式的特点。通过对比各种I/O方式的特点,探讨在实际应用中如何选取最优的I/O方式,并给出一通用的I/O方式选择标准。 相似文献
14.
超级并行计算机的设计目标之一是,计算能力与I/O性能保持匹配和均衡,随着大规模并行处理技术的发展和现代科学与工程技术研究的需要,超级计算机计算能力与I/O处理能力不协调问题越来越突出,愈发成为超级并行计算机发展的制肘因素,本文分析了I/O系统发展滞后的原因,讨论了几种超级并行计算机I/O系统的结构,并对如何提高和充分发挥超级计算机并行I/O性能,从系统结构,互连技术,I/O服务节点选择及软件设计等方面进行了探讨。 相似文献
15.
TMS320C20X在数字信号处理方面具有较大的优势,而I/O控制口线相对较少。对于很多控制应用,往往同时对外部设备控制及数值计算都有较高要求,这些口线远不能满足要求。 在利用串行口进行输出口线的扩展时,需要将DSP的串行输出数据转换为并行输出端口的状态,这里利用了串并转换芯片74HC164来完成这一功能。 相似文献
16.
1 引言计算机的总体性能主要依赖于它的五个主要组成部分的性能,即处理器、内存、总线、存储器和显示子系统等。在过去十多年里,计算机的各个组成部分的性能有了不同程度的提高,尤其是作为处理核心的微处理器的性能更是得到了长足的发展;但是,整个计算机的体系结构仍基本沿用了基于共享 相似文献
17.
18.
19.
20.
随着大规模和超大规模集成电路技术的飞速发展,计算机的应用已渗透工业过程控制、智能化仪器仪表、网络技术、家用电器、办公自动化等有关科技领域,而这些应用则离不开计算机接口技术,计算机接口技术已日益成为直接影响计算机系统功能和计算机推广应用的关键技术。 相似文献